Energy-Efficient Microcontrollers: Unveiling Ambiq AI's Innovative Solutions
Ambiq AI stands as a pioneering force in the realm of ultra-low power microcontrollers. Their innovative devices leverage groundbreaking technology, notably their proprietary Subthreshold PowerSwitching (SPSM) platform, to achieve unprecedented levels of energy efficiency. This remarkable feat empowers a wide range of applications, particularly in areas where energy consumption is paramount.
From wearable devices and Industry 4.0 applications to medical monitoring systems, Ambiq's microcontrollers are redefining the landscape of low-power design.
